Illinois Engineered Products Inc Salary

How much does the Illinois Engineered Products Inc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Illinois Engineered Products Inc in the United States is $97,674.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$47. Salaries at Illinois Engineered Products Inc typically range from $86,009 to $110,257 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Illinois Engineered Products Inc’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Chicago?

Understanding the cost of living near Chicago is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Illinois Engineered Products Inc.
Chicago's Cost of Living Index is approximately 106.9 (6.9% more expensive than US average; 14.0% more than IL average). Major US city, housing varies greatly by neighborhood but can be high, extensive CTA trans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Illinois Engineered Products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,700 - $2,600+ A significant portion of Illinois Engineered Products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$105 (CTA 30-day p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$640 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,225 - $5,025+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
